SQL Injection Vulnerability in Campcodes Online Teacher Record Management System
CVE-2025-5626
What is CVE-2025-5626?
A SQL injection vulnerability exists in the Campcodes Online Teacher Record Management System version 1.0, specifically within the '/admin/edit-subjects-detail.php' file. This vulnerability allows an attacker to manipulate the 'editid' parameter, leading to unauthorized data exposure or manipulation. The issue can be exploited remotely, making it crucial for users of this system to apply safeguards immediately, as this vulnerability has been publicly disclosed and may be actively exploited.
Affected Version(s)
Online Teacher Record Management System 1.0
